Frequently asked questions

What does “psychotherapy” mean?

The word “psychotherapy” means treatment of mental and emotional problems through talking with a trained therapist. In plain terms, talk-based treatment for mental health issues, delivered by a trained therapist.

How do you pronounce “psychotherapy”?

“Psychotherapy” is pronounced seye-koh-THEH-ruh-pee (/ˌsaɪkoʊˈθɛɹəpi/ in IPA).

How do you use “psychotherapy” in a sentence?

Here is “psychotherapy” used in a sentence: “He credits years of psychotherapy with helping him manage his depression.”

What part of speech is “psychotherapy”?

“Psychotherapy” is a noun.
